Position Summary

We are looking for a Senior Data Scientist with over 10 years of professional experience to join a critical 6-month project in Pleasanton, CA. This onsite role requires a deep understanding of machine learning, deep learning, and large-scale data engineering. You will be responsible for building, evaluating, and deploying sophisticated models that drive significant business value and operational efficiency for our client. This is a high-impact role requiring both technical depth and strategic thinking.

Core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ement advanced machine learning models using Python and SQL to solve complex business challenges.
  • Perform comprehensive data wrangling, cleaning, and feature engineering to prepare datasets for modeling.
  • Build and optimize deep learning architectures using frameworks such as TensorFlow, Keras, or PyTorch.
  • Apply NLP, computer vision, and time-series forecasting techniques to diverse use cases.
  • Design and optimize complex SQL queries involving window functions, CTEs, and advanced joins.
  • Create insightful data visualizations and dashboards using Tableau, Power BI, or Matplotlib to tell stories with data.
  • Deploy models into production-scale environments using Flask, FastAPI, and containerization tools like Docker.
  • Collaborate with data engineering teams to build and maintain robust data pipelines using Spark, Hadoop, and Airflow.
  • Conduct model evaluation using metrics like Precision/Recall, ROC-AUC, MSE, and RMSE, followed by rigorous model tuning.

Technical Expertise

  • 10+ years of professional experience in Data Science, Analytics, or a related quantitative field.
  • Expertise in classical Machine Learning algorithms including Linear/Logistic Regression, Decision Trees, Random Forest, XGBoost, and LightGBM.
  • Strong proficiency in Python (Pandas, Scikit-learn, Seaborn, Plotly) for data prep and modeling.
  • Hands-on experience with Cloud platforms, specifically AWS (S3, EC2, SageMaker), Azure (Databricks), or GCP (BigQuery).
  • Familiarity with Big Data frameworks like Spark and Hadoop for processing large-scale datasets.
  • Knowledge of CI/CD basics and deployment workflows in a production environment.
